Original Title
Return of the Living Sluts
Plot Summary
In the sequel to Night of the Living Sluts, the state is trying to prosper despite the devastating effects of the virus.
Release Date
November 20, 2021
Original Title
Return of the Living Sluts
Plot Summary
In the sequel to Night of the Living Sluts, the state is trying to prosper despite the devastating effects of the virus.
Release Date
November 20, 2021